Malaysia – Cryptocurrency, the exciting, transitory new wave of technology has a shady underside of issues and scams. Crypto crimes, including as unlawful bitcoin mining, have surged dramatically in 2021, according to Bukit Aman Criminal Investigation Department (CID) head Datuk Seri Abd Jalil Hassan. Malaysia – The Malaysian men’s team topped Group B and qualified for the semi-finals of the Badminton Asia Squad Championships (BATC) 2022 with a 3-2 victory against a second-string Japanese team. Malaysia, the 2020 runners-up, will face South Korea in the men’s semi-finals, while defending champions Indonesia will face Singapore.
